PhoenixShi
Note, this is a review regarding the En Masse release, some releases of the game aren't regarded as well as this one is, which may explain some of the negative reviews. . VERY solid game with true action gameplay in an open world MMO. The action isn't as fast, and responsive as say a single player action game, or one of those town hub instanced dungeons online games, but for an open world game, it's much more of an action game than most any other MMO out there. They keep making adjustments, that actually prove to usually benefit the game, unlike some others where updates just seem to take what was a good game, and make it worse. This doesn't mean I think everything they do is great, but I agree with the changes far more often than I'm against them. The profit model is also very fair, with it mainly revolving around cosmetics, boosts to gains, and extra quality of life befits like easier fast travel. Many complain about the quests, but most can be completely ignored if you don't like them, just go bash mobs, and collect the rewards from the repeatable quests for doing so from the UI, rather than a NPC. As you level up mobs will drop shards that will give you some very nice weapons appropriate for your level. The repeatable quests you can get rewards for from the UI also give you tokens you can exchange for armour, and accessories, as well as provide you with crystals for your equipment. Result of this is that gearing up a levelling character is very easy, the equipment grind is just at end-game, and by the time you get there, which doesn't take too long, you'll know if that's a class you want to invest in. That's some examples of the kind of changes they've made to the game for the better.

Macros
The once innovative idea of putting a little bit of action grew old with time, but if there is a good side to it, it would be that. Graphics are good in theory but in practice, the game is extremely poorly optimized with thought of single core processors and dx9, it wasn't good even when it was released and gotten only worse with updates which forces even 980ti users to run on low in some dungeons and cities as is often reported on forums. The game has always been essentially pay 2 win - that is the most important Asian versions (Korean and Japan). Same is true for European Gameforge version. It has been known that the only exception, ever since the game went f2p, was the North American version. But even for Tera NA it should be noted that from day one you can buy level 60 and get to 65 in an evening (60 to 65 levels were added on top of what was designed when they game was buy 2 play and are very fast to go through on purpose with a set of special quests). Then, you can buy the best gear in the game and also a premium subscription that gives you twice the amount of rewards for everything that matters, twice the amount of dungeon runs a day - which are limited and free stuff daily like dungeon reset scrolls allowing you to progress 4x faster than a standard player. Inventory and bank space is also limited and has to be expanded with microtransaction items. All that items can be traded with in game money if somebody already paid real money for it and certain parts of armor can only be bought or upgraded efficiently with paid items (and by efficiently I mean that instead of getting them in one day you may spend 100 days fighting with rng). Having those items isn't a necessity but often nobody will want to play with you any proper dungeons if you don't buy them, it will be okay if you have 5 friends but otherwise you'll end up complaining at the forums like other people. Please keep in mind i'm describing the Tara NA which is considered to NOT be p2w - what that means is that BHS - the company making the game - often doesn't care about that version as it doesn't bring them much money, many things that are broken because for e.g. Tera NA decided to not put certain items in microtransactions store are often fixed with a year of delay. Realistically it would take about 4-6 months of playing 2-4h a day to get the gear paying users get in first month and with 6 month gear cycles making old gear worthless players are forced to start from 0 or pay every 6 months. The pvp content always used to be extremely unbalanced across the classes and even though NA and EU community used to really enjoy the pvp part, BHE sees the game as a PVE game and has been neglecting pvp, releasing more and more imbalanced classes, incentivising people to pay for gear, levels etc. for those new classes. The old classes are right now mostly irrelevant and often kicked from parties for not contributing enough to the run. Furthermore, each patch dungeons are being deleted from the game giving less and less content to play while releasing less dungeons which are often criticised to be " yet another rehash of old dungeons". Thus the endgame consists mostly of mundane task endlessly grinding mobs for vanguard points that are used to buy materials for enchanting which essentially is a gold sink . Killing 2400 mobs killing aprox.400 per 15 min. (with 5 top level characters) which yields a total of minimum 1h30min but more realistically 2h of mindless grind (look for "tera tar quest" videos) gives you enough materials for 2.88 enchant attempts. With number of tries averaging 100 to fully enchant one out of four enchantable gear pieces and ranging even up to 350 tries enchanting at least your weapon (most crucial part for running top dungeons and pvp, which requires a separate set of gear) it can take you up to 243 hours of mindless grind. Or you could pay and get better enchanting materials, or gold and just buy materials from other players. But, as they say, if it can be gained with in game means it's not pay 2 win. The support is horrible and while professional with responses it can take them a week to respond depending on type of your ticket (under an hour if it's money related) and you'll always get the samey, schematic, sorry can't do answer. On the plus side, the game, because of it's action nature, doesn't suffer from botters. It's worth noting that a lot of community is toxic but that's typical for online games, and that all new classes are race locked and gender locked to oversexualized females (e.g. Elins). Music is limited and mediocre. Lore unimportant since the game went f2p. If you never played an action mmo it can be a fresh experience for a while, making the grind to lvl.65 on first character even somewhat enjoyable.

Promiskuitiv
I'm playing on NA (en masse) so some things may be different for EU (gameforge) and i'm also playing more PvE than PvP. Pros: - Truly free to play, spending money isn't necessary to compete if you're not borderline inactive. - The community on TERA is by far the best i've ever met in any MMORPG, that may be related to my specific server but that doesn't make it any less amazing. That alone would make me keep playing, but of course there are other reasons too. - The combat is really fluid and fun, especially against huge endgame PvE bosses / in PvP fights. - TERA's world is really amazing and makes for many beautiful screenshots. - With many different races + character customization options including an insane amount of different looking armors / costumes you can make your character look the way you want it to. - On TERA NA you can buy items you would usually only get with real money (cosmetic stuff / elite status) with ingame money, so if you play multiple times a week you can easily get both while not ever paying for anything if you so desire. Cons: - Most areas in the game are more than fine in terms of fps but when you visit a highly populated city your fps are likely to go below 20. Opening some UI as the inventory also makes your fps drop for a split second. Some of the huge end bosses also noticeably lowered fps for me (all graphic options are on max though). - If you're looking for complete immersion then TERA probably isn't for you, there are a lot of immersion breaking mounts and costumes. - The story isn't really jaw dropping, for me it's more about the interaction with other players and combat but a more compelling story wouldn't have hurt either. All in all i would've rated this game an 8, but since i haven't found any other online RPG which hooked me like TERA did this deserves an extra point from me.
